From 2911b7dec62c6abb059895dec49c04fe46af2e79 Mon Sep 17 00:00:00 2001 From: "nissim.hadar" Date: Sat, 25 Nov 2017 11:41:05 -0800 Subject: [PATCH] Fix gcc error, and MAC error (no pow). --- tools/auto-tester/CMakeLists.txt | 2 +- tools/auto-tester/src/ImageComparer.cpp | 4 ++-- 2 files changed, 3 insertions(+), 3 deletions(-) diff --git a/tools/auto-tester/CMakeLists.txt b/tools/auto-tester/CMakeLists.txt index 0c85ff597c..8c0294adf1 100644 --- a/tools/auto-tester/CMakeLists.txt +++ b/tools/auto-tester/CMakeLists.txt @@ -8,7 +8,7 @@ SET(CMAKE_AUTOMOC ON) setup_hifi_project(Core Widgets) # Add compiler flags for building executables (-fPIE) -set(CMAKE_POSITION_INDEPENDENT_CODE ON) +set(CMAKE_POSITION_INDEPENDENT_CODE TRUE) # Qt includes include_directories(${CMAKE_CURRENT_SOURCE_DIR}) diff --git a/tools/auto-tester/src/ImageComparer.cpp b/tools/auto-tester/src/ImageComparer.cpp index 7a67750df1..2616f7f1ea 100644 --- a/tools/auto-tester/src/ImageComparer.cpp +++ b/tools/auto-tester/src/ImageComparer.cpp @@ -22,8 +22,8 @@ double ImageComparer::compareImages(QImage resultImage, QImage expectedImage) co } const int L = 255; // (2^number of bits per pixel) - 1 - const double c1 = pow((K1 * L), 2); - const double c2 = pow((K2 * L), 2); + const double c1 = (K1 * L) * (K1 * L); + const double c2 = (K2 * L) * (K2 * L); // Coefficients for luminosity calculation const double RED_COEFFICIENT = 0.212655f;